> Now opening the Browse dialog with event as "NewDialog" instead of
> "SpawnDialog" and in the browse dialog using the event again as "NewDialog"
> instead of "EndDialog" when clicking on "OK" / "Cancel" button.
>
> Not sure if this will lead to any performance issues or anything else but
> this is an alternative solution.
>
> Bob, do you see any issues using this workaround?
>   

It means that you won't be able to use the dialog from any other dialog; 
with SpawnDialog, EndDialog returns to whatever dialog was active before.
